Is Polyurethane Food Safe?
It depends on the specific formulation. Polyurethane is a family of polymers, not a single material, and food contact status is determined formulation by formulation. In the United States, FDA regulations under Title 21 of the Code of Federal Regulations define which polymer materials may be used in contact with food and under what conditions. A polyurethane film engineered and tested for food contact can carry that compliance. A generic industrial urethane cannot borrow it just because it looks similar.
What a Food Contact Rating Actually Tells You
A compliance statement is more than a yes or no. It ties the material to conditions of use, and those conditions are where plants get caught off guard during audits.
Conditions of Use Matter
Food contact regulations distinguish between things like dry foods, aqueous and fatty foods, temperature ranges, and single versus repeated use. A material rated for dry powder contact is not automatically suitable for hot, oily product. When you evaluate a connector or tubing material, match the rating to how the material will actually be used on your line.

Detectable Polyurethane and Your HACCP Program
Detectability is worth a special mention. If a fragment of a standard plastic connector breaks off into the product stream, inline metal detectors and X-ray systems will not see it. Materials like X-Spy are engineered so fragments can be caught by the detection equipment you already run, turning a potential recall scenario into a rejected package. For many food safety teams, that is the deciding factor between two otherwise similar polyurethanes.
How to Verify a Material Before It Goes on Your Line
- Ask for the compliance documentation for the exact material, not the product family.
- Confirm the rating covers your food type, temperature, and repeated-use conditions.
- Keep the documents accessible for audits and customer questionnaires.
